Candidate Committees
The next report due for Candidates Running in the 2019 Special Election for Honolulu City Council, District 4 is the Late Contributions Report for reporting contributions from any person aggregating more than $500 received during the period of March 30 through April 9, 2019. The report must be electronically filed on the Candidate Filing System (“CFS”) no later than 11:59 p.m. Hawaiian Standard Time on Wednesday, April 10, 2019.
The Late Contributions Report is only required if late contributions are received by the candidate or candidate committee. Late contributions on this report will also be listed on the Final Election Period Report; however, the contribution data is only entered once in the CFS on the “Schedule A – Contributions” screen. The report can be previewed and printed in the CFS by clicking “Preview/Print Report” and then “Special Report.” Under the “Election Type” drop-down, select “Special” and then under the “Select Report” drop-down, select “Late Contributions Report.” Click the “Preview” button to preview the report. If you see late contributions that you entered for the March 30 through April 9, 2019 period then you are required to file the report. To file the report, click “File Report” and then “Special Report.” Under the “Election Type” drop-down, select “Special” and then under the “Select Report” drop-down, select “Late Contributions Report.” Click the “File Report” button to file the report.
Candidates and treasurers of candidate committees are also reminded of their acknowledgment and certification on the “Candidate Committee Electronic Filing Form” that the information on all reports electronically filed online are true, complete, and accurate. See, Hawaii Revised Statutes §§11-321(c)(1), 11- 331(a), and 11-340(a).

*Hawaii Revised Statutes, §11-334(a)(3) provides that the filing date for the final election period report is thirty calendar days after a general, subsequent, subsequent special, or subsequent nonpartisan election. The report shall be current through the day of the applicable election. However, a candidate who is elected and is to be sworn into office prior to thirty calendar days after a general, subsequent, subsequent special, or subsequent nonpartisan election in which the candidate was elected, shall file the final election period report three business days before the date the candidate is to be sworn into office.
